Lifetime Experience Safaris was a trip of a lifetime! Upon arrival at Entebbe airport Baylon met us and we were on our way. There are not enough kind words to say about Baylon. He is a wonderful person and excellent driver/guide. He knew where to go to get the best pictures of Elephants, Lions, Leopards, Hippos, Giraffes, Crocodiles, and numerous other wildlife. We started our trip at the Rhino sanctuary- and on that trek we spotted 10 Rhinos! After that we went on Murchison Falls National Park. While in Murchison NP we went on 2 Safari drives, a Nile cruise, a hike to the top of Murchison Falls! All accommodations during the 9 days were fantastic. We picked the "moderate" level for accommodations. The meals were also very good.

After Murchison NP we headed to Kibale for our Chimp trek. This was truly amazing. We then went on to Queen Elizabeth National Park for more safari drives and tree climbing lions!

The highlight of our tour was seeing the Mountain Gorillas at Bwindi. Even though it was raining we were able to see two families of Gorillas on the side of the mountain. it was truly mystical. Memories for a lifetime!

After Bwindi we stopped at Lake Mburo National Park and there we saw Zebras and Impalas, along with other wildlife.

We made a deposit on our trip via credit card. A 3% credit card fee was added on. This is done in most places in Africa because they cannot afford to absorb that fee. We paid the balance of our safari in U.S. dollars once we arrived.

My 4 friends and I did a lot of research and quote requests on SafariBookings before reaching the decision to go with Kanuth. WE NEVER LOOKED BACK. We chose the 4 day 3 night Serengeti Safari and chose to camp all 3 nights. The price point for this safari was perfect and we were a little worried how the quality would be sacrificed but nothing about this safari felt budget. I cannot say enough good things about our driver Vumi or our cook Eric. Vumi, our driver, was in the loop with all the other drivers and would radio over when we saw something or vis versa then speeding along to ensure we saw whatever animal he was told about. He quickly learned what we loved seeing and skillfully drove us around ensuring we got the most of our days! Eric, our cook, made us feel very special to have a private chef with us. We had a vegetarian on the trip and all meals had multiple spectacular options for everyone! The Ngorongoro campsite was amazing and many other groups were there as well, the Serengeti one was nice as well with a few other groups (there is no fence and animals are around you all night just a heads up!), and the Tarangire one we were the only people and everything was fine but it was a little more rough.
